Kenyan hotels bank on events, domestic tourism to keep business alive

Share

The Standard | by Standard Team

The decrease in Covid-19 cases and the gradual opening of the hotels post lockdown has brought a ray of hope for the hospitality industry in Kenya.

Although very low on occupancy currently, hoteliers are optimistic that the domestic market and other segments will gradually pave the way for business.
